1. Tooth Enamel Is Strong!

The enamel is the outer layer of the tooth that protects and shields the sensitive components of the inner tooth. Most people do not know that their tooth enamel is the hardest substance within their body. This means that that outer layer of each tooth is harder than bones. It makes sense when you think about all the hard things people bite into every day.

2. Your Teeth Are Unique

While this may seem like an obvious fact, some people may never actually think about it. Each person has their own set of unique teeth. Nobody on this earth has the same teeth, Just like fingerprints, the teeth are so unique that they can help identify a person.

Just ask your Baton Rouge dentist about how law enforcement officials use dental records to catch criminals. Even more interesting, archaeologists can use a skeleton’s teeth to learn about ancient people.

4. Your Teeth Start to Form Before You Are Born

Babies are not born with a full set of teeth, right? They actually have tooth buds for all their teeth from birth. They have buds for the 20 primary teeth that will eventually fall out. Even more shocking, they have tooth buds for the 32 permanent teeth that they will have for life. The only teeth you do not have from birth are the wisdom teeth. They start to form when you are a teenager.
